Our Story
Simpli Baked’s story began in a small bakery in Limerick, where founders Kieran and Sean honed their craft under the watchful eye of their father. As a fifth-generation baker, Kieran deeply values the traditions and skills passed down through his family. Though their father never got to see Simpli Baked’s success, his influence is woven into every step of their journey.

Before starting Simpli Baked, Kieran spent time internationally selling Irish food, an experience that opened his eyes to new opportunities. Through a mutual customer, he met his business partner Niels, and in 2008, Simpli Baked was born. What started as a modest ambition to build a team of 15-20 people quickly exceeded expectations, with the company growing steadily year after year.
In 2015, Simpli Baked faced one of its greatest challenges when a fire destroyed their factory in Clara. Thankfully, no one was hurt, and the team’s resilience turned this setback into a new chapter. With the overwhelming support of customers and the local community, they rebuilt their factory in just 300 days, moving operations to Tullamore. This period marked a pivotal moment as the company embraced its identity as Ireland’s first gourmet wraphouse.

Offaly food firm bucks trend by creating new jobs
A locally based tortilla and pizza base company has managed to increase employment numbers and production in the face of the Covid-19 pandemic.
Simpli Baked, the food manufacturing business based at Cloncollig in Tullamore, recently employed 12 extra full-time team members to help them meet production demands.
This brings the workforce to a total of 62 full-time team members at the plant.

Tullamore firm wins national award
Tullamore firm Simpli Baked was amongst the winners at the Small Firms Association (SFA) National Small Business Awards, which took place in Dublin on Wednesday.
Simpli Baked won the Bord Bia sponsored Food and Drink Award, seeing off the challenge of firms from Longford, Mayo, Galway and Wexford.
